As a player should the focus be on the odds of winning or how often people are winning regardless? How often (other) people win matters in two ways. If somebody else wins the same drawing you do you only get your share of the jackpot. If anybody won recently the jackpot is less than it is when nobody has won for a longer period of time. One thing I truly miss is bump up to the jackpot like in the good old days. Gone for good I'd say. Considering that they've done it 4 times in the last 4 months it hardly seems like it no longer happens. Changing to 3 drawings per week has a minor effect, but the real issue is that lottery sales per drawing are generally slower than they used to be.
